Bathroom Fan Replacement in Littleton, CO
Bathroom fan replacement services involve removing an existing exhaust fan and installing a new unit to ensure proper ventilation in bathrooms. This project typically covers various types of fans, including ceiling-mounted models, humidity-controlled fans, and high-capacity units for larger bathrooms. Property owners often seek this service when their current fan is no longer functioning effectively, making noise, or failing to control moisture levels, which can lead to mold and mildew issues. Before requesting replacement, it’s helpful to understand the size and type of fan currently installed, as well as any specific features or performance levels desired in the new unit.
Homeowners should also consider the location of the fan and the ductwork’s condition, as these factors can influence installation requirements and overall effectiveness. Proper ventilation is essential for maintaining a healthy bathroom environment, and selecting the right replacement fan can improve air quality and reduce humidity problems. Clarifying these details beforehand can help ensure the new fan meets the needs of the space and fits properly within existing fixtures or duct connections.

Bathroom Fan Replacement Questions
When should a bathroom f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the fan is noisy, not venting properly, or showing signs of damage or wear.
What signs indicate a bathroom fan needs replacement? Common signs include persistent noise, reduced airflow, electrical issues, or visible corrosion.
Can a bathroom fan be upgraded to a quieter model? Yes, upgrading to a newer, quieter model can improve ventilation and reduce noise during operation.
Is it necessary to replace the entire fan or just parts? It depends on the issue; some problems may be fixed with parts, but complete replacement is often recommended for optimal performance.
